Woman mistakenly texts drug deal to deputy
North Carolina woman found herself behind bars last week after mistakenly texting a sheriff’s deputy a drug deal message.
The McDowell County Sheriff’s Office said Amy Leigh Brown, 35, sent Deputy P.V. Alkire a text stating, “Hey it’s Amy. Do you want business tonight?”
The McDowell News reported that Alkire did not recognize the number, but he texted Brown back that she should meet him at a nearby truck stop.
Brown also allegedly texted the deputy that she had some “bones,” which is street slang for the anti-anxiety drug alprazolam, sold commercially as Xanax, the newspaper reported.
Alkire went to the truck stop and confronted Brown, who was the passenger in a car. She denied sending the texts and deleted the messages from her phone. Alkire then called the number the texts were sent from, and Brown’s phone rang, the sheriff’s office told the newspaper.
